What ¶¶ÒõÊÓÆµEmpower offers
The ¶¶ÒõÊÓÆµEmpower package includes:
- Personal development opportunities to help you build confidence, leadership and transferable skills. These include opportunities such as studying abroad, getting involved in student leadership roles and taking part in experiences that help you grow beyond your course.
- Health and wellbeing services to help you look after your mental and emotional wellbeing. This includes access to counselling services, wellbeing support, and digital tools such as Togetherall, helping create an environment where all students can thrive.
- Careers and employability support embedded throughout the student journey. This includes work placements, mentoring opportunities, careers workshops and access to careers advice for life, continuing even after graduation.
- Entrepreneurial and innovation opportunities for students with ideas they want to develop. Through initiatives such as the ¶¶ÒõÊÓÆµ Startup Studio, students can access guidance, resources and support to explore enterprise and innovation.
- Academic and learning support to help you stay on track and get the most from your studies. All students are supported by a Personal Academic Tutor (PAT), alongside access to wider learning and academic skills support, like the Effective Learning Services (ELS).
- Transition, international and financial guidance to help students settle into university life and access opportunities throughout their time at ¶¶ÒõÊÓÆµ, including tailored support for international students and guidance around funding and financial wellbeing.
